On 17/05/2025 02:02, Atish Patra wrote:
> On 5/16/25 8:21 AM, Clément Léger wrote:
>> The S-mode PMU driver might need to enable/disable SSE event regularly
>> in order to mask SSE events.This commits reworks the PMU SSE callback.
>> SSE register/unregister now just sets the MIDELEG register and
>> enable/disable now set/clear MIE. MIP clearing is also removed from
>> pmu_sse_enable() since it could lead to losing pending interrupts.
>>
> 
> The changes looks good. However, can you please split into two commits ?
> One for register/unregister part and another for MIP change ?
> 
> The MIP clearing part is a critical change for any future SSE event
> similar to LCOFIP. Thus, I would prefer the history preserves why MIP
> was removed explicitly.

Yes sure, that makes sense.
